If you've reached State pension age, contact the Pension Service for a claim form.
State pension age varies depending on your gender and when you were born. Visit http://pensions.direct.gov.uk/en/state-pension-age-calculator/home.asp to find out if and when you will be eligible for the state pension.

The Pension Service will contact you about three months before you reach the state pension age. They will ask you to fill in a form telling them whether you want to start taking your state pension and how often you want it to be paid.

Many people are tempted to simply buy an annuity from their pension provider. This might actually turn out to be the best deal for you, but, as with most other things, you might be able to get a better deal from another provider. Annuity providers may offer different rates for different types of annuity, so it's worth your while asking for quotes from a number of different companies. You don't lose anything by doing this and you may actually end up with a better income. You can ask a financial adviser to help you ask for quotes from a number of companies. This is known as the open market option.
